Russia’s gold output grew by about 8% YoY, to 235.999 tons in January-September, the Union of Gold Producers of Russia said in a statement on December 14.

Miner gold production rose by 7%, to 188.763 tons, byproduct production by 14%, to 12.946 tons, and scrap gold output rose by 3%, to 27.203 tons.

Silver output fell by 7%, to 1,182.89 tons in the period. (Prime/Ukrainian metal)
